If current GSM operator is defined as Home Operator, device will work in Home Data
Acquisition mode, if current operator is defined as Roaming Operator, device will work in
Roaming Data Acquisition mode, and if current operator code is not written in Operator list (but
there is at least one operator code in the operator list), device will work in Unknown Acquisition
mode.
This functionality allows having different AVL records acquire and send parameters values
when object is moving or stands still. Vehicle moving or stop state is defined by Stop Detection
Source parameter. There are 3 ways for FMA110 to switch between Vehicle on Stop and Vehicle
Moving modes see section 5.7.
FMA110 allows having 6 different modes. Operational logic is shown in Figure 24.
If there are no operator codes entered into operator list, FMA110 will work in
Unknown network mode ONLY.
Operator search is performed every 15 minutes. Depending on current GSM operator,
Home, Roaming or Unknown mode can be changed faster than every 15 minutes. This process is
separate from operator search. Movement criteria are checked every second.
